Broken Arrow (1996)

Continuity mistake: The mine is 600 meters deep. Deakins offloaded the bomb at ground level, started sending the elevator down, and then dropped two hand grenades down the shaft. In the next clip the elevator is at the bottom of the shaft, and the grenades hit the bomb. For that to happen the elevator must have free-fallen to the bottom, not descended as we see it.

Broken Arrow (1996)

Factual error: The train is supposed to be heading East. But in several shots, the sun is on the left side of the train (and still high in the sky). The left side of the train would be Northwest (or North) and the sun would not be there.

Broken Arrow (1996)

Factual error: The helicopter explodes while still in the air when hit by the EMP. It might cause it to shut down (and crash) but not explode in the air.

Broken Arrow (1996)

Factual error: When Kelly falls from the train he falls straight down - compared to the bridge pillars. But since he falls out of a moving train, he would have had some forward speed too.
